
要查看Excel文件的当前路径,可以使用多种方法,包括通过VBA代码、文件属性和Excel内置函数。这些方法包括使用公式、VBA宏以及文件管理器等。以下将详细介绍这些方法中的一种:通过Excel内置函数公式查看当前文件的路径。
一、通过公式查看Excel文件路径
使用Excel内置函数可以方便地查看当前文件的路径。在Excel中,你可以使用CELL函数来获取当前工作簿的路径、文件名和工作表名称。具体的公式如下:
=CELL("filename", A1)
这个公式会返回一个字符串,包含当前工作簿的完整路径、文件名和工作表名称。例如,如果你的文件位于"C:UsersUsernameDocuments"文件夹中,文件名是"example.xlsx",工作表名称是"Sheet1",则公式会返回如下字符串:
C:UsersUsernameDocuments[example.xlsx]Sheet1
你可以使用Excel的文本函数进一步处理这个字符串,以提取你需要的信息,例如路径、文件名或工作表名称。
二、使用CELL函数提取路径
在上一节中我们使用了CELL函数来获取路径、文件名和工作表名称的组合字符串。接下来,我们将讨论如何使用Excel的文本函数来提取具体的路径信息。
1、提取文件路径
要提取文件路径,我们可以使用LEFT和FIND函数。下面是具体的步骤:
=LEFT(CELL("filename", A1), FIND("[", CELL("filename", A1)) - 1)
这段公式的作用是提取左侧字符,直到第一个方括号[为止。这样,我们就能得到不包含文件名和工作表名称的文件路径。
2、提取文件名和工作表名称
如果你还需要提取文件名和工作表名称,可以使用MID和FIND函数。以下是分别提取文件名和工作表名称的公式:
提取文件名:
=MID(CELL("filename", A1), FIND("[", CELL("filename", A1)) + 1, FIND("]", CELL("filename", A1)) - FIND("[", CELL("filename", A1)) - 1)
提取工作表名称:
=MID(CELL("filename", A1), FIND("]", CELL("filename", A1)) + 1, LEN(CELL("filename", A1)) - FIND("]", CELL("filename", A1)))
三、通过VBA代码查看文件路径
如果你对编程有一定了解,可以使用VBA(Visual Basic for Applications)代码来查看当前文件的路径。VBA提供了更灵活和强大的功能。
1、打开VBA编辑器
在Excel中按下Alt + F11打开VBA编辑器,然后插入一个新的模块。
2、编写VBA代码
在新模块中输入以下代码:
Sub ShowFilePath()
MsgBox "The current file path is: " & ThisWorkbook.Path
End Sub
运行这个宏将会显示一个消息框,包含当前Excel文件的路径。你也可以将路径信息保存到单元格中:
Sub InsertFilePath()
Range("A1").Value = ThisWorkbook.Path
End Sub
四、通过文件属性查看路径
除了在Excel内部查看路径,你还可以使用文件管理器查看文件路径。以下是具体步骤:
1、使用文件资源管理器
打开文件资源管理器,导航到你保存Excel文件的目录。右键点击文件,选择“属性”。在“常规”选项卡下,你可以看到文件的路径。
2、复制路径
在文件资源管理器的地址栏中,你也可以直接复制当前文件夹的路径。
五、使用Excel加载项或插件
你还可以使用一些第三方Excel加载项或插件来查看文件路径。这些工具通常提供更多的功能和更友好的用户界面。
1、安装加载项
在Excel中,转到“文件”->“选项”->“加载项”。选择你需要的加载项并安装。
2、使用加载项查看路径
安装完成后,加载项通常会在Excel的功能区中添加一个新的选项卡或按钮。按照加载项的使用说明查看文件路径。
六、总结
查看Excel文件的当前路径有多种方法,包括使用Excel内置函数、VBA代码、文件属性和第三方加载项。每种方法都有其优点和适用场景,选择适合自己的方法可以提高工作效率。无论你是Excel初学者还是高级用户,这些技巧都能帮助你更好地管理和使用Excel文件。
希望以上内容对你有所帮助。如果你有任何其他问题或需要进一步的解释,请随时联系我。
相关问答FAQs:
1. 如何在Excel中查看当前文件路径?
- Q: 我在Excel中如何查看当前打开的文件的路径?
- A: 在Excel中查看当前文件路径很简单。只需按下键盘上的“Ctrl”键和“S”键,然后在弹出的对话框中,可以看到文件路径信息。
2. 如何快速获取Excel文件的当前路径?
- Q: 我需要快速获取Excel文件的当前路径,有什么方法可以做到吗?
- A: 是的,您可以使用快捷键来快速获取Excel文件的当前路径。只需同时按下“Ctrl”+“L”,然后在工具栏的地址栏中,就可以看到当前文件的完整路径。
3. 如何在Excel中找到当前正在编辑的文件的路径?
- Q: 当我在Excel中编辑一个文件时,如何找到该文件的路径?
- A: 要找到当前正在编辑的Excel文件的路径,可以点击Excel窗口左上角的“文件”选项卡,然后选择“信息”选项。在“文件信息”页面中,您可以找到文件的完整路径。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4304653